About the Alappuzha

Alappuzha (also known as Alleppey) is a charming city in Kerala, India, renowned for its serene backwaters, lush greenery, and vibrant culture. It's often called the 'Venice of the East' due to its intricate network of canals, lagoons, and rivers. A houseboat cruise through these waterways is a quintessential Alappuzha experience.

Best Time to Visit

September to March. The weather is pleasant and ideal for houseboat cruises and sightseeing. The monsoon season (June to August) is also beautiful, with lush greenery, but heavy rainfall may disrupt outdoor activities.

Activities / Things To Do in Alappuzha

  • Take a Houseboat Cruise Embark on a relaxing houseboat cruise through the backwaters. Enjoy the scenic views, indulge in delicious Kerala cuisine, and witness the local way of life along the canals. Overnight stays on houseboats are a popular option.
  • Visit Alappuzha Beach Relax on the golden sands of Alappuzha Beach. The beach offers stunning views of the Arabian Sea and is a great place to watch the sunset. The old pier and lighthouse are popular attractions.
  • Explore the Vembanad Lake Vembanad Lake, the largest lake in Kerala, is a beautiful expanse of water. You can take a boat ride on the lake, go fishing, or visit the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ary located on its banks (see nearby destinations).
  • Visit the Ambalappuzha Sri Krishna Temple This temple is famous for its Palpayasam (sweet milk porridge), a delicious offering to Lord Krishna. The temple also features traditional Kerala architecture and is an important pilgrimage site.
  • Explore the local markets Visit the local markets in Alappuzha town to experience the vibrant atmosphere and shop for souvenirs, spices, handicrafts, and coir products.
  • Kayaking or Canoeing For a more active experience, consider kayaking or canoeing through the backwaters. This allows you to explore the narrower canals and get closer to nature.

How to Reach Alappuzha

Air

The nearest airport is Cochin International Airport (COK), located about 78 kilometers from Alappuzha. Taxis and buses are readily available to reach Alappuzha from the airport.

Bus

Alappuzha is well-connected by road to other cities in Kerala and neighboring states. Kerala State Road Transport Corporation (KSRTC) buses and private buses operate frequently.

Train

Alappuzha has a well-connected railway station (ALLP). Regular trains connect Alappuzha to major cities in India.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best way to experience the backwaters?
A houseboat cruise is the most popular and comfortable way to experience the backwaters. You can also explore them by canoe, kayak, or local ferry.
Is Alappuzha safe for tourists?
Yes, Alappuzha is generally safe for tourists. However, it's always wise to take precautions against petty theft and scams. Be aware of your surroundings and keep your valuables secure.
What are the local languages spoken in Alappuzha?
Malayalam is the primary language spoken in Alappuzha. English is also widely understood, especially in tourist areas.
How can I book a houseboat cruise?
You can book a houseboat cruise online through various travel websites or directly through houseboat operators. It's recommended to book in advance, especially during peak season.
Are there ATMs available in Alappuzha?
Yes, ATMs are readily available in Alappuzha town and other tourist areas.
What kind of food can I expect on a houseboat?
Houseboats typically serve traditional Kerala cuisine, including rice, fish curry, vegetables, and spices. You can often request specific dishes in advance.
Is alcohol available on houseboats?
Yes, alcohol is generally available on houseboats, but it's best to check with the operator beforehand. Some houseboats may allow you to bring your own drinks.
